A 65-year-old man (ASA III) with a tracheostomy is being weaned from ventilation. He is on a T-piece with humidified oxygen 28%. He suddenly becomes agitated with SpO2 dropping to 75%. A suction catheter will not pass beyond the tracheostomy tube. According to the emergency tracheostomy algorithm, after removing the inner cannula (which does not resolve the obstruction), what is the next step?

Correct answer: ADeflate the cuff – if this relieves the obstruction continue with cuff deflated

Following the NTSP/DAS/ICS emergency tracheostomy algorithm: after checking breathing circuit connections and removing the inner cannula (first steps), if the tube remains blocked, the next step is to deflate the cuff. If cuff deflation relieves the obstruction (suggesting the tube was malpositioned or the cuff was occluding the lumen against the tracheal wall), oxygenation via the upper airway may now be possible. If this fails, the tracheostomy tube should be removed entirely and primary oxygenation should be attempted from above (oral route) while simultaneously assessing the stoma for patency.

Reference: DAS/ICS/NTSP – 2023 – Emergency tracheostomy management guidelines
